Local denial of service via atomic allocation
Published Nov 7, 2024 · Updated May 11, 2026
Improper locking in affected Linux 6.4 and later branches allows local users to interrupt service through scheduler activity. In task_tick_mm_cid(), task_work_add() records a KASAN auxiliary stack that can allocate pages while the raw runqueue spinlock is held, causing an invalid sleep in atomic context. Reachability requires both KASAN and PREEMPT_RT, and the documented consequence is a kernel BUG with availability loss rather than data disclosure or modification.
